M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
considers
subjects
having to do with open
education resources
and
massively open online courses.
New
changes in
elearning technology are enabling
people
in all parts of the world
to be participants in online classes.
These massive open online courses are
mostly free
but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
There are numerous
issues that
online learning institutions
are having to struggle with
in 2015 because distance learning technology is
developing so rapidly.
How can institutions
ensure that
the schooling provided by these
massively open online courses is
satisfactory?
How can stakeholders
make sure that
lecturers are properly credentialed
to teach online MOOC classes?
What different strategies are being used by
organizations like
UWashingtonX to conduct these MOOC classes?
What experimental evaluation strategies and teaching practices are optimal?
How can we
handle issues like
low
student motivation and high
learner dropout rates?
